Federal Student Loans

These are offered by the federal government, have relatively low interest rates, and also flexible payment plans. In addition, they allow deferring payments when required and can also receive an income-driven repayment plan.

Advantages of federal student loans:

  • Low interest rate as compared to private loans
  • There are several options to repay a loan: Standard, Income-Driven, Graduated
  • Eligible borrowers are qualified for programs of loan forgiveness

What is Refinancing?

It refers to replacing your current loans with a new one that comes with different terms and interest rates. This may result in your lower interest rate and, therefore, lower the amount of interest that accumulates over the term of your loan.

The following are some benefits that come along with refinancing:

  • Lower Interest Rate: Refinancing can help you get a lower interest rate, especially if your credit score has increased since you first borrowed the loans.
  • Simplification on Pay: If you have several student loans, refinancing ensures that you pay all of them in one monthly instalment. This way, you do not miss any due dates.
  • Flexible Terms: Refinancing will enable you to be in control of your terms of repayment since you will have a choice of the time that is best for you financially.

What is Loan Consolidation?

Consolidation refers to the situation in which more than one student loan is taken and converted into one single loan at a particular interest rate which is fixed. Perhaps, the interest rate is not the one that will be reduced as a result of consolidation but it makes easier in terms of tracking the amount of money you owe in terms of the number of payments that one has to make.

Some of the best benefits of consolidation include the following:

  • Single Monthly Payment: Consolidation aggregates several loan payments into just one payment monthly.
  • Long Repayment Period: Consolidation will extend your loan tenure and decrease your monthly installments. In the process, that will increase the interest you pay over the period of the entire loan.
  • Fixed Interest Rate: It is a fixed rate for you since it is based on the weighted average of your present loans.

Popular Student Loan Forgiveness Programs:

  • Public Service Loan Forgiveness (PSLF): Specific unsubsidized Direct Loans for government or nonprofit careers are dischargeable for any remaining loan stability with ten years of continuous payments.
  • Teacher Loan Forgiveness: On the other hand, if a teacher works at a low-income school, he or she can have up to $17,500 in loans forgiven.
  • Income-Driven Repayment (IDR) Forgiveness: For IDR plans, after making qualifying payments for 20 or 25 years from the date that your first payment becomes due, the rest of the amount can be discharged.
